Understanding 15w50 Transmission Oil: What Makes it Special?
The numbers “15w50” on an oil bottle tell a crucial story about its viscosity, or its resistance to flow, at different temperatures. This isn’t just a random label; it’s a carefully engineered specification designed for specific operational demands.
Decoding the Viscosity Numbers
The “W” stands for “winter,” indicating the oil’s performance at lower temperatures. A “15W” rating means the oil flows like a 15-weight oil when cold, providing relatively easy starts and lubrication during chilly conditions. This is vital for minimizing wear during initial startup.
The “50” refers to the oil’s viscosity at operating temperature. This higher number indicates a thicker oil when hot, offering robust protection under heavy loads and high heat. This dual-viscosity nature is what makes 15w50 a multi-grade lubricant, adapting to a wide range of operating environments.
Key Properties and Characteristics
15w50 transmission oil is typically formulated with a blend of high-quality base oils and advanced additive packages. These additives are critical for its performance, providing properties such as:
- Extreme Pressure (EP) Protection: Essential for protecting gear teeth from metal-to-metal contact under heavy stress.
- Thermal Stability: Resists breakdown and oxidation at high temperatures, preventing sludge and varnish formation.
- Shear Stability: Maintains its viscosity even under intense shearing forces, ensuring consistent protection.
- Corrosion and Rust Inhibition: Protects internal components from environmental damage.
- Foaming Resistance: Prevents air bubbles that can reduce lubrication effectiveness.

Specific Vehicle Types and Applications
Manual Transmissions
Many heavy-duty or high-performance manual transmissions benefit from 15w50, particularly if they experience high loads, frequent towing, or spirited driving. The robust film strength protects gears and synchronizers effectively.
Differentials and Transfer Cases
For rear differentials, front differentials (in 4x4s), and transfer cases, especially in off-road vehicles or those used for towing, 15w50 can provide excellent protection. These components often see extreme pressure and heat. However, some differentials require specific gear oil (e.g., GL-5 rated), so always double-check the exact fluid type and viscosity.
Motorcycles (Wet Clutch Compatibility)
Many motorcycles, particularly those with a shared sump for the engine, transmission, and wet clutch, can utilize 15w50. It’s crucial to ensure the oil is “JASO MA” or “JASO MA2” certified. This certification guarantees it contains the correct friction modifiers (or lack thereof) to prevent clutch slippage. Using a standard automotive 15w50 engine oil without this rating in a wet clutch system can lead to serious clutch issues. This is a critical tip for motorcycle riders.
Considerations for Climate and Driving Style
Even if 15w50 is an option, your local climate and driving habits play a role. In extremely cold environments, the “15W” might still be too thick for optimal cold-start lubrication in some transmissions, potentially leading to harder shifts until warm. Conversely, in consistently hot climates or with heavy-duty use (like towing a large RV), the “50” hot viscosity provides superior protection.
When *Not* to Use 15w50 Transmission Oil
It’s equally important to know when 15w50 is NOT appropriate:
- Automatic Transmissions: Never use 15w50 in an automatic transmission. These require very specific Automatic Transmission Fluid (ATF) with entirely different friction characteristics.
- Vehicles Requiring Thinner Oils: Many modern manual transmissions are designed for much thinner oils (e.g., 75W-80, 75W-90, or even specific engine oils like 10W-30) to improve fuel economy and shift feel. Using 15w50 in these could cause hard shifting, poor lubrication, and potential damage.
- Specific Gear Oil Requirements: Some differentials and transfer cases demand dedicated gear oils (e.g., GL-4 or GL-5) with specific additive packages. While 15w50 engine oil can sometimes substitute for gear oil in certain applications, it’s not a direct replacement for all. Always verify.

Step-by-Step Instructions for Your 15w50 Transmission Oil Change
- Locate Plugs: Identify the drain plug (usually at the bottom) and the fill plug (often on the side) of the transmission, differential, or transfer case. Sometimes there’s also a check/level plug.
- Loosen Fill Plug First: This is a crucial 15w50 transmission oil tip. Always try to loosen the fill plug *before* removing the drain plug. If you drain the fluid and can’t open the fill plug, your vehicle is stuck!
- Position Drain Pan: Place the drain pan directly under the drain plug.
- Remove Drain Plug: Carefully remove the drain plug. Be prepared for the oil to come out quickly. Allow all the old 15w50 transmission oil to drain completely.
- Inspect and Replace Washer: Inspect the drain plug for damage and replace the crush washer if applicable.
- Reinstall Drain Plug: Thread the drain plug back in by hand to avoid cross-threading, then tighten it with your torque wrench to the manufacturer’s specified torque. Do not overtighten!
- Refill with New Oil: Using your funnel and hose, carefully pour the new 15w50 transmission oil into the fill hole.
- Check Level: Most manual transmissions, differentials, and transfer cases are full when the fluid starts to seep out of the fill hole. For some, a dipstick might be present. Check your manual for the exact procedure.
- Reinstall Fill Plug: Once the level is correct, reinstall the fill plug, again using a new crush washer if needed, and tighten to the specified torque.
- Clean Up: Wipe down any spilled oil and inspect for leaks around the plugs.

Recognizing Signs of Old or Contaminated Fluid
Your transmission fluid speaks volumes about its condition. Here’s what to look for:
- Dark, Burnt Smell: Healthy 15w50 transmission oil is usually amber or clear. If it’s dark brown or black and smells burnt, it indicates severe heat stress and breakdown.
- Metallic Sheen: A metallic sheen or visible particles in the fluid suggest internal component wear. A slight sheen might be normal break-in, but significant amounts are a red flag.
- Milky or Foamy Appearance: This often points to water contamination, which is particularly bad for transmissions and differentials.
- Unusual Consistency: If the oil feels gritty or excessively thin, it’s time for a change.
Catching these signs early can prevent minor issues from escalating into major transmission problems.

Common Problems with 15w50 Transmission Oil (and How to Avoid Them)
Even with the best intentions, mistakes can happen. Understanding the common problems with 15w50 transmission oil usage and maintenance can help you avoid costly errors and keep your transmission running smoothly.
Using the Wrong Type or Viscosity
This is perhaps the most frequent and damaging mistake. As discussed, 15w50 is not universally applicable.
Using it where a thinner oil (e.g., 75W-90 gear oil or a different engine oil viscosity) is specified can lead to:
- Hard Shifting: The oil might be too thick to properly lubricate synchronizers or flow correctly through small passages.
- Increased Drag: Thicker-than-recommended oil can create excessive internal friction, leading to reduced fuel economy and power.
- Inadequate Lubrication (paradoxically): In some modern transmissions designed for thin oils, a thick oil might not penetrate small clearances effectively, leading to premature wear.
How to avoid: Always, always consult your owner’s manual. If you’re unsure, ask a professional.
Overfilling or Underfilling
Both scenarios are detrimental to your transmission:
- Overfilling: Can lead to aeration (foaming) of the oil as moving parts churn it. Foamy oil doesn’t lubricate effectively, leading to heat buildup and wear. It can also create excessive pressure, causing leaks or damage to seals.
- Underfilling: Means insufficient lubrication for critical components. This results in increased friction, excessive heat, and rapid wear of gears, bearings, and synchronizers. It’s a direct path to transmission failure.
How to avoid: Follow the manufacturer’s specific filling and level-checking procedures precisely. Use a level surface for checks and fills.

Frequently Asked Questions About 15w50 Transmission Oil
What’s the difference between 15w50 engine oil and 15w50 transmission oil?
While both share the same viscosity rating, their additive packages are significantly different. Engine oil is designed to handle combustion byproducts and protect against wear in an engine. Transmission oil (or gear oil) contains specific extreme pressure (EP) additives crucial for protecting the meshing gears and bearings in a transmission, which experience much higher localized pressures. Using engine oil in a transmission not designed for it, or vice-versa, can lead to premature wear and failure.
Can I mix 15w50 transmission oil with other viscosity oils?
It is generally not recommended to mix different viscosities or types of transmission oil. Mixing can dilute the additive packages, alter the intended viscosity, and potentially lead to unpredictable performance or reduced protection. Always drain the old fluid completely and refill with the specified type and viscosity.
How often should I change 15w50 transmission oil?
The change interval for 15w50 transmission oil varies greatly by vehicle type, manufacturer recommendations, and driving conditions. For most manual transmissions, differentials, and transfer cases, it’s typically every 30,000 to 60,000 miles. However, heavy-duty use (towing, off-roading) or extreme climates may necessitate more frequent changes, possibly every 15,000 to 30,000 miles. Always consult your vehicle’s owner’s manual first.
Is 15w50 suitable for all motorcycles?
No, 15w50 is not suitable for all motorcycles. While many motorcycles with shared sumps (engine, transmission, wet clutch) can use 15w50, it is crucial that the oil carries a “JASO MA” or “JASO MA2” certification. This ensures it has the correct friction characteristics for wet clutches. Using standard automotive 15w50 engine oil without this certification can cause clutch slippage and damage. Always check your motorcycle’s owner’s manual for the exact oil specifications.
